Nicolae Hurmuzachi

Nicolae Hurmuzachi (March 19, 1826–September 19, 1909) was an ethnic Romanian journalist and folklorist from Bukovina in Austria-Hungary.

He traveled to Paris and Berlin before settling in his native village.

He undertook political and cultural activities on behalf of the Romanian community in Bukovina.

In 1862, he was a founding member of the Romanian Reading Society in Cernăuți, and from 1879 was on the governing board of the Society for Romanian Literature and Culture in Bukovina.

Named a baron of Austria in October 1881, he was elected an honorary member of the Romanian Academy in April 1883.
